When the Malone University volleyball team hosts the Walsh University Cavaliers in a 7:00 p.m. contest in Malone's Osborne Hall Tuesday evening (Nov. 5th), a "red sea" will likely be a part of the frenzied festivities as numerous Malone students are expected to be wearing red at the historic rivalry event.
The Pioneers will look to avenge an earlier loss to Walsh on the Cavaliers' home court in early October as Walsh made Malone see red with a 25-23, 19-25, 29-27, 25-23 victory over the Pioneers in a match in which all three of Malone's set losses came by the narrowest of margins.
Looking back to last season (2012), though, Malone swept the two-match series against Walsh with both victories coming in four sets.
As a special event between the second and third sets of Tuesday's match, four Malone students will compete in the "Castaway Challenge" to see who can draw the best "Wilson face!" The crowd will choose the winner, who will receive a $20 gift certificate to Milk and Honey.
Malone has an overall record of 10-14 and a 5-8 mark in the GLIAC while Walsh holds a record of 5-18 overall and a 2-11 record in GLIAC play.
